Linda Litt #12 on the Covered Bridge Art Studio Tour stop Oct 10-12th




 Linda Litt has been totally entranced with watercolors ever since she received watercolor paints as a gift from my daughter. She loves the beautiful transparency of watercolor. Linda always amazed at the unlimited ways colors mix on their own, making unusual shapes and textures. Linda loves to play with watercolors. She is intrigued by the natural world. Linda’s subjects are varied including local landscapes, mountains in Alaska, close-ups in nature, still lives, people, and even abstracts. Linda loves to play with color and light and shadows when she paints.
